PFT Tank concrete repair

Problem

The concrete to the top of the PFT tank was under attack from the Hydrogen Sulphide gas which has caused the concrete to spall badly, revealing the rebar in places. The seal between the roof and the wall had also failed and was causing damage to the concrete to the outside of the tank.

These pictures show the condition of the concrete and seal at the top of the PFT Tank.

Solution - Internal Repair

  • The area to be repaired was grit blasted
  • A new seal was injected between wall and roof
  • The worst affected areas were rebuilt using a Belzona concrete repair product which is resistant to the hydrogen sulphide attack
  • All prepared areas were then spray coated with Belzona 5811 to prevent any further damage.

Solution - External Repair

  • Identify the problem areas.
  • Apply the Belzona concrete repair system to reinstate the thickness of walls to correct level.
